Celebrity esthetician Rene Rouleau says that "When vitamin E is combined with vitamin C and used under sunscreen, it can provide four times the protection of sunscreen alone., Retinoids are a category of ingredients, and retinol products for lines and wrinkles are available over the counter.

PMID: 33456250; PMCID: PMC7802860. And while picking up differentmakeup tips and tricks is wonderful, the one thing I am always most fascinated by is the sort of products skin experts swear by.

These vitamin-A derivatives have a long track record of proven efficacy, working both on the surface of the skin to help with things such as tone and texture, as well as deeper in the skin to boost collagen production and smooth wrinkles. Look for products that include these anti-aging ingredients, which can target multiple different signs of skin aging, including fine lines, skin dryness and dull complexion, brown spots and uneven complexion: Chang explained to HuffPost how each of the above ingredients work: Vitamins C, B3 (niacinamide) and E are strong antioxidants that have been shown to repair the skin from free radical damage as well as brighten the skin, improve the complexion and stimulate collagen production.
